NOVAMIX FIBER

Synthetic fibers for reinforcing cement based mortars or industrial concrete floors

Synthetic fibers for the reinforcement of concrete based industrial floors and cement screeds (e.g. on industrial floors with NOVADUR S final cover). Due to their special composition they can be also used for reinforcing low thickness mortars such as wall levelling compounds, plasters, tile adhesives, in order to increase their tensile strength and slip resistance.

Application:

Polypropylene fibers are added directly to the concrete or mortar mixing  system, while batching the ingredients. Mix the mixture well for at least 2  minutes.

Use 6 mm fibers if the aggregates are less than 10 mm. In case the aggregates  are bigger than 10 mm then use 18 mm fibers.

The recommended amount is at least 600 g / m³ of concrete or mortar.

Recommendations:

  • Polypropylene fibers do not replace the concrete static reinforcement
  • The standard rules of good concreting practice, concerning production as  well as placing, are to be followed
  • Fresh concrete must cure properly
